Handover — Puzzlewright crossword generator

Hey Dovan, passing this to you before I'm out. The grid filler works but the clue ranker in Thistlecore sometimes loops on 15x15 themed puzzles — there's a retry cap in the config, don't raise it. Nightly builds publish to the Marrowgate staging shelf. To restore the seed dictionary from the encrypted archive, you'll need the recovery passphrase given just below.

unlock words, hahip-baduf: holwyn-istath-julvan

// Heads up, plugin folks: this module backs the `tailwick` CLI that
// streams logs from the Fernmoor aggregator. Your plugins inherit
// these defaults unless you override them in your manifest, so don't
// assume you can buffer forever or poll aggressively. If the tailer
// falls behind it drops oldest lines first. The tuning constants are
// defined immediately below.

constants for bajog-bagaf:
QUOTAS = {
    "istdor": 762,
    "wenius": 555,
    "casael": 720,
    "beldor": 311,
    "quenir": 159,
}

# Break-Glass Access — EchoDocent

Welcome aboard! EchoDocent is the audio-guide app we run for the Marlowe Hollow Museum. Normally you'll never touch prod directly — everything goes through the Tidegate deploy pipeline. But if the pipeline is down and visitors can't stream tours, we have a break-glass path: an emergency operator account on the primary node. Ping whoever's on call first, always. Once they approve, unlock the break-glass vault with the recovery passphrase below.

strongbox words: druox-olimir